Let x represent the width of the river. The distance from the point across from the tree to the second point is 15 m. The angle from this point to the tree across the river is 76°.
This makes the side opposite the angle x, the width of the river. It also means the 15 m side is adjacent to this angle.
The ratio opposite/adjacent is the ratio for tangent; this gives us the equation
x/15 = tan(76)
Multiply both sides by 15:
15(x/15) = 15(tan(76))
x = 15(tan(76)) ≈ 60.2
Two angles are said to be linear if they are adjacent angles formed by two intersecting lines. The measure of a straight angle is 180 degrees, so a linear pair of angles must add up to 180 degrees.
